• 1
  • 2
  • 3
  • 4
  • 5
阿里云应用开发 首 页  »  帮助中心  »  云服务器  »  阿里云应用开发
浅析IBM的Websphere敏捷性杠杆和全面进入NEXT SOA时代理论
发布日期:2016-3-24 15:3:0
 

  浅析IBM Websphere敏捷性杠杆和全面进入NEXT SOA时代理论

  最近,IBM Websphere在京召开新产品媒体发布会,针对SOA、云计算、BPM等重点领域进行全新的产品和技术升级。IBM软件集团WebSphere开发与产品组合管理副总裁Beth T. Smith提出了敏捷性杠杆(agility levers)以及Next SOA,再次强调IBM WebSphere持续投入和不断创新,以帮助客户实现转型、创新及成长。

  一、三大敏捷性杠杆

  根据IBM进行的全球CEO调研结果表明,为了应对市场需求变化并对此快速反应,很多企业的CEO需要非常高效快速的转型来满足复杂的市场需求。IBM提出了敏捷性杠杆这一概念,以帮助客户在变化的时代取得优势,从决策、流程和技术三方面,帮助客户更好的做出业务决策。Beth T. Smith认为,"敏捷性杠杆指的是一系列能力的整合,客户通过这些能力,能够很容易地通过IT部署进行变化,以应对业务环境中的快速有效的需求。敏捷性杠杆的目标,就是让客户从现在的IT投资,以及从服务导向当中获取更大的价值。"

  敏捷性杠杆分为三部分,流程、决策以及技术。下面对三部分分别作简要介绍:

  1、在业务流程方面,业务流程管理是基于SOA基础之上的,通过敏捷性杠杆,能够帮助客户更快的做出业务决策,实现流程优化,更好的应对业务中面临的挑战和变化。IBM Business Process Manager V7.5 for z/OS是发布的新产品,它是用于大型机的操作系统,其中融合了zEnterprise,CIS、IMS和DB2等,以便于提供很好的内容处理能力。

  2、在业务决策方面,通过增强业务规则和业务实践相应能力,帮助企业提高业务决策能力,IBM推出了新工具WebSphere Operational Decision Mangement V7.5,这个工具简称WODM,能够为企业实现加速敏捷,应对市场需求,简单的可视化、业务决策管理的自动化以及确保业务系统所传递作用的正确性。通过决策这一敏捷性杠杆,使用分析工具和业务规则来提高企业的运营决策能力,以及更好地应对市场需求变化。

  3、在技术方面,客户面临着肯多挑战。“企业中的各种开发程序都是基于不同的技术开发出来的,而各个组件在开发的时候都是独立、分散的。客户要创建新的服务,高效快速的实现开发,这就需要具备多平台的开发能力。通过敏捷性杠杆,可以快速的实现应用交付,开发者不在以孤岛的方式孤立的开发服务组件。”Beth T. Smith这样告诉记者。IBM将Exclude Option、 Rational等软件集成到Websphere Application Server中,提供给客户大量工具集,帮助他们实现快速有效的开发。在私有云环境中,开发者能够通过IBM Workload Deployer v3.1来定义配置方式及应用负载,能够高速便捷的部署以及维护。在开发部署中,通过敏捷性杠杆,帮助客户在同一基础架构的多个领域中,实现信息的共享。

  二、全面进入NEXT SOA时代

  如今SOA构架越来越被企业所重视和接受,SOA在全球都得到了很广泛的部署,但客户对于SOA有了更高的希望,他们希望把SOA和企业的业务需求更加紧密地联系在一起,帮助企业实现更加敏捷的部署,使企业的IT基础架构具有更强的灵活性。

  在SOA稳步落地和云计算高度被关注的环境下,业务敏捷性要求企业能够适应外界和内部的变化,提升创建新业务或改变老业务过程的系统能力。出色的IT架构,应该能够支持系统能力的建立和提升信息整合、决策支持、流程重组,以上每一项对于IT技术都是很大的挑战。

  Beth T. Smith提出了NEXT SOA的概念,“NEXT SOA就是把有效IT工具与服务整合在一起,继而继续推广。IT服务是以SOA为架构的,客户需要在已有的资产和服务的基础上,充分调动IT工具,具备更强的能力应对更多更快的变化。但是在IT服务的基础上要把业务服务添加进来,举个例子,比如以后的业务流程,也就是把服务加进来以后,使业务流程能力达到一个更高的水平。

  总而言之,WebSphere致力于通过完美的技术整合和领先的应用帮助优化企业的IT架构,为其提供整合、可扩展的系统以实现卓越性能,从而帮助企业增强敏捷力,建立高效的业务流程管理,并以云计算模式,高效实现服务交付转型,创造全新的业务模式。IBM通过SOA促进了服务流程的可用性,并将业务需求与IT功能真正意义上结合起来,对所有的IT技术进行全方位的监控,对它的性能监管、可用性,建立起统一的告警和实践管理平台,并从业务的角度来对一个企业核心的业务支撑平台,关键的业务流程进行监控。